16 Rue Sainte-Anne, Québec, QC G1R 3X2, Canada
French Bistro perfectly located right in the heart of old Quebec. Come and experience our selection of meats, wine and cocktails in a cozy and relaxing ambiance.

It is a restaurant located in a historic 17th-century building in Quebec City, Quebec, Canada. Situated on Rue Saint-Anne, it is located across Place dArmes from the Château Frontenac. it looks amazing, especially in the rain and at night.
